He was born January 15, 1962 in Morgantown, a son of Geraldine Wolfe Gamble of Westover and the late Robert Elias Gamble.
He is survived by his wife Marsha Michelle Hess Gamble; his children, Crystal, Bryan, Amy and Lena; his grandchildren, Sierah, Mikey, Zoey, Katie, Angel, Ashton, Kaden, Dylon, Alec, Aaliyah , Kaelyn and Lloyd; a sister, Rebecca Gamble; a brother, Richard Gamble; a niece, Chelsa Gamble, several aunts, uncles and cousins; and a special friend, Anna Abrams.
Robbie was a 1981 graduate of University High School/ He was employed in Maintenance by the Louis A Johnson VA Medical Center in Clarksburg, and PACE Tech.
Growing up, he was active in Boy Scouts and 4-H, and was very actively involved with Scott's Run Settlement House.
Mr. Gamble loved working with crafts, painting and crocheting. Also, he enjoyed listening to Country, Christian and Christmas Music. He was a member of the Reynoldsville Baptist Church.
Family and friends will be received at Hastings Funeral Home, 153 Spruce St., Morgantown, on Tuesday, February 18th from 1-3 and 5-8 PM and again on Wednesday, February 19th from 11:30 AM until the time of the funeral service at 12:30 PM with Pastor Jon Hayes officiating. Interment will follow in the Olive Cemetery, Pentress.
